summaryrefslogtreecommitdiffstats
path: root/src/panfrost
Commit message (Expand)AuthorAgeFilesLines
* pan/bi: Add IR iteration macrosAlyssa Rosenzweig2020-03-051-0/+59
* pan/bi: Add quirks systemAlyssa Rosenzweig2020-03-056-3/+69
* pan/bi: Add high-latency property for classesAlyssa Rosenzweig2020-03-052-11/+15
* pan/bi: Add CSEL conditionAlyssa Rosenzweig2020-03-051-0/+4
* pan/bi: Add bi_branch dataAlyssa Rosenzweig2020-03-051-0/+32
* pan/bi: Extract bifrost_branch structureAlyssa Rosenzweig2020-03-051-0/+16
* pan/bi: Add pred/successors to build CFGAlyssa Rosenzweig2020-03-051-0/+4
* pan/bi: Add constants to bi_clauseAlyssa Rosenzweig2020-03-051-0/+4
* pan/bi: Add EXTRACT, MAKE_VEC synthetic opsAlyssa Rosenzweig2020-03-051-1/+4
* pan/bi: Add source type for conversionsAlyssa Rosenzweig2020-03-051-0/+3
* pan/bi: Add swizzlesAlyssa Rosenzweig2020-03-052-1/+13
* pan/bi: Clarify special op schedulingAlyssa Rosenzweig2020-03-052-1/+5
* pan/bi: Add clause header fields to bi_clauseAlyssa Rosenzweig2020-03-051-0/+19
* pan/bi: Add class-specific opsAlyssa Rosenzweig2020-03-051-0/+26
* pan/bi: Add constant field to bi_instructionAlyssa Rosenzweig2020-03-051-0/+8
* pan/bi: Add special indicesAlyssa Rosenzweig2020-03-051-0/+19
* pan/bi: Add dest_type field to bifrost_instructionAlyssa Rosenzweig2020-03-051-0/+6
* pan/bi: Add bi_clause, bi_bundle abstractionsAlyssa Rosenzweig2020-03-051-1/+39
* pan/bi: Add PAN_SCHED_* flagsAlyssa Rosenzweig2020-03-052-23/+32
* pan/bi: Add bi_load_vary structureAlyssa Rosenzweig2020-03-051-0/+12
* pan/bi: Pull out bifrost_load_varAlyssa Rosenzweig2020-03-052-4/+24
* pan/bi: Add bi_load structureAlyssa Rosenzweig2020-03-051-0/+10
* pan/bi: Add bifrost_minmax_mode fieldAlyssa Rosenzweig2020-03-051-0/+5
* pan/bi: Add a bifrost_roundmode fieldAlyssa Rosenzweig2020-03-052-2/+8
* pan/bi: Factor out enum bifrost_minmax_modeAlyssa Rosenzweig2020-03-052-4/+11
* pan/bi: Add BI_GENERIC propertyAlyssa Rosenzweig2020-03-052-5/+10
* pan/bi: Add modifiers to bi_instructionAlyssa Rosenzweig2020-03-051-0/+7
* pan/bi: Add class propertiesAlyssa Rosenzweig2020-03-054-0/+64
* pan/bi: Add src/dest fields to bifrost_instructionAlyssa Rosenzweig2020-03-051-0/+41
* pan/bi: Add the control flow graphAlyssa Rosenzweig2020-03-051-0/+52
* pan/bi: Stub out new compilerAlyssa Rosenzweig2020-03-056-3/+85
* pan/bi: Gut old compilerAlyssa Rosenzweig2020-03-0515-2110/+54
* panfrost: Add note about preloaded varyingsAlyssa Rosenzweig2020-03-051-0/+5
* pan/bi: Move some definitions from disasm to bifrost.hAlyssa Rosenzweig2020-03-032-62/+62
* pan/bi: Structify FMA_FADDAlyssa Rosenzweig2020-03-032-8/+35
* pan/bi: Squash LD_ATTR ops togetherAlyssa Rosenzweig2020-03-032-33/+37
* pan/bi: Combine LOAD_VARYING_ADDRESS instructions by typeAlyssa Rosenzweig2020-03-032-5/+29
* pan/bi: Decode ADD_SHIFT properlyAlyssa Rosenzweig2020-03-032-21/+46
* pan/bi: Identify extended FMA opcodesAlyssa Rosenzweig2020-03-031-119/+127
* pan/bi: Add v4i8 mode to FMA_SHIFTAlyssa Rosenzweig2020-03-032-1/+3
* pan/bi: Decode FMA_SHIFT properlyAlyssa Rosenzweig2020-03-032-24/+48
* pan/bi: Move notes on ADD ops to notes fileAlyssa Rosenzweig2020-03-032-44/+80
* pan/bi: Introduce CSEL4 classAlyssa Rosenzweig2020-03-032-24/+52
* pan/bi: Move notes on FMA opcodes from disassemblerAlyssa Rosenzweig2020-03-032-79/+101
* pan/bi: Add ICMP.GL.NEQ opAlyssa Rosenzweig2020-03-031-0/+1
* pan/bi: Add discard opsAlyssa Rosenzweig2020-03-031-0/+7
* pan/decode: Skip analysis for Bifrost tiler structuresAlyssa Rosenzweig2020-03-031-1/+34
* pan/decode: Fix tiler weights printingAlyssa Rosenzweig2020-03-031-2/+2
* pan/decode: Restore bifrost sample_locationsAlyssa Rosenzweig2020-03-032-9/+66
* pan/decode: Calm an assert to a pandecode errorAlyssa Rosenzweig2020-03-031-2/+2